BARCELONA, Spain: Al Manar Racing by Team WRT’s Al Faisal al Zubair, Jens Klingmann and Ben Tuck head into the last race of the GT World Challenge Europe powered by AWS season aiming to round off their endurance campaign with the Gold Cup title at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ya on the weekend (October 11-12).


The BMW M4 GT3 EVO trio are currently second in the Drivers’ Championship, 16 points adrift of the Verstappen Racing.com trio of Thierry Vermeulen, Chis Lulham and Harry King after claiming victory at the last round at the Nurburgring. They trail their rivals by 12 points in the Teams’ Championship. CSA Racing also has a mathematical shot at the title.


Al Manar Racing has already secured the overall Gold Teams’ Championship before the final round and finished the Sprint season in fourth in both the Teams’ and Drivers’ Championships.


Oman-based Al Zubair said: “Looking forward to the race this weekend, the final round of the championship and the last of the endurance rounds. We are in a great place in the overall championship (Drivers), having secured second. In endurance, we are in second place, 16 points behind the leaders and we still have a shot at winning the endurance title. We will be going all-in for it.


“Barcelona is a circuit I usually like but it’s a difficult track for the BMW. Let’s hope that the BOP is on our side this weekend and we can give a strong fight and end the championship in a great way.”


This weekend’s finale has attracted a record 60-car field and the largest ever assembled for this event at the Spanish circuit. In addition to the title contenders, Optimum Motorsport, Team RJN and Garage 59 will field a trio of McLarens, the Tresor Attempto Racing Audi is present along with the Paul Motorsport Lamborghini in the Gold Cup category.


The GTWC finale shares the circuit with the Lamborghini Super Trofeo, GT2 European Series powered by Pirelli and the GT4 European Series powered by RAFA Racing Club.


Two hours of free practice gets underway from 09.00hrs, local time on Saturday morning. This is followed by pre-qualifying, starting at 14.35hrs.


Race qualifying will be split into a short stint for each driver from 10.25hrs on Sunday and the final three-hour endurance race of the season fires into life at 15.00hrs (CET).


GTWC ENDURANCE


TEAMS – latest Gold Cup standings


1. Verstappen.com Racing 106 pts


2. Al Manar Racing by Team WRT 94 pts


3. CSA Racing 84 pts


4. Team RJN 36 pts


5. Optimum Motorsport 36 pts


6. Garage 59 34 pts


7. Herberth Motorsport 33 pts


8. Paul Motorsport 33 pts


9. Tresor Attempto Racing 29 pts


10. Ring Motorsport 23 pts


DRIVERS – latest Gold Cup standings


1. Lulham/Vermeulen/King 106 pts


2. Al Zubair/Klingmann/Tuck 90 pts


3. Gachet/Rougier/Kell 84 pts
